- #Original doom size .exe
- #Original doom size install
- #Original doom size Patch
- #Original doom size windows 10
- #Original doom size code
Now, as far as the MS-DOS version goes, you simply can't run it with less than 4 MB of physical RAM (it's even hardcoded to check for that). The lowest-end experience possible with Doom on the "IBM pee-cee compatible" would be a 386 SX/16, with an 8-bit ISA VGA card -)Įxtra "awesome" if you somehow manage to find a non-IDE HD (preferably, a ST-506 interface 20 or 30 MB hard disk from the XT era). ISA: 16-bit, 8 MHz (overclockable to 13.333 MHz if you used CKLI/3 on a 40 MHz CPU), VESA: 32-bit and locked to the CPU speed, thus up to 50 MHz on a 486. In terms of speed differences, it would be like comparing PCI (non-express) with AGP 8x or PCIe 16x. Tweaking stuff like on-card wait states and overclocking the ISA bus itself did help in getting better framerates, however there was no comparison with a real 486 which had the benefit of a VESA local bus video card. With the above mentioned 486DLC, the main bottleneck was the ISA VGA card it had to use as nothing but a dumb framebuffer, and most low-end VGAs weren't really good at it. When in the minimum specs it says "VGA card", you should make that a " fast VGA card". 386 25MHz as a minimum, while for Doom 2/Final Doom they recommended a 486 and 8 MB of RAM straight away, even though it still worked with 4) but the only hard and fast requirements for playing Doom was having a machine running DOS, having an i386 compatible CPU, and 4 MB of RAM (and of course, enough HD space to store Doom). Id later on made those specs a bit more precise (e.g. 4 MB of RAM also don't leave much headroom for large levels or heavy modifications, and disk trashing fucks things up. Mind you, whether it's really enjoyable or merely "executable" on a low-end 386 or even a low-end 486 (33 MHz or lower) is also debatable. The only way to run it "below system requirements", would be trying to run in with less than 4 MB of addressable memory, which is impossible to do under DOS, or with a not-so-quite 386 CPU. There's a slight difference between "required" and "recommended" specs.Ī 386 is well withing the "minimum" game requirements. A 486 orīetter, a Sound Blaster Pro(TM) or 100% compatible sound card
![original doom size original doom size](https://cdn.shopify.com/s/files/1/1601/3103/products/MTG_DoomBlade_orijinal-size_TdeH_1200x.jpg)
![original doom size original doom size](https://i.ebayimg.com/images/g/PZoAAOSwQmxgnn2X/s-l300.jpg)
RAM, a VGA graphics card, and a hard disk drive. +++ b/SDL_net-1.2.8/SDLnet.c 18:49:24.DOOM(TM) requires an IBM compatible 386 or better with 4 megs of
#Original doom size Patch
Apply this patch to SDL_net to eliminate the dependency on iphlpapi.dll:ĭiff -ur a/SDL_net-1.2.8/SDLnet.c SDL_net-1.2.8/SDLnet.c.sudo mv /usr/local/lib/libSDL_mixer.* /usr/local/cross-tools/i386-mingw32/lib/ sudo mv /usr/local/include/SDL/SDL_mixer.h /usr/local/cross-tools/i386-mingw32/include/SDL/ (I could probably also have just set prefix correctly).
#Original doom size install
configure -enable-shared -enable-static -host=i686-w64-mingw32 make sudo make install configure -enable-shared -enable-static -disable-directx -host=i686-w64-mingw32 make sudo make install
#Original doom size code
#Original doom size .exe
exe file with a "polyglot" MZ header which allows it to load one program (the original DOOM) when running inside DOS, and a different program (a custom static build of Chocolate DOOM) when running on Windows. However, this is complicated by a few facts: DOS support was dropped in Windows a long time ago (DOS binaries don't load on Windows 10, for example), and DOS programs use a completely different execution environment. exe files both start with a common header (the DOS "MZ" header), which might suggest that you can run programs for one OS on the other one.
![original doom size original doom size](https://i.ebayimg.com/images/g/O4EAAOSwMS5eZMCx/s-l640.jpg)
#Original doom size windows 10
exe binary which runs DOOM on DOS 6, Windows 95 and Windows 10 (and probably everything in between).